The Shriners' Hospital for Children (EIN: 04-2121377)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, The Shriners' Hospital for Children,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 6 out of 353 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$1,066,530. The highest compensated employee at The Shriners' Hospital for Children is John McCabe with fiscal year 2024 compensation of $4,000,753.
